Generating OTP fba6d5ffa87b572fbaf7891385670d7ebc2c9b3570405e7d87cd854f6a275bf2 for 216.73.216.103. Result is 90376fda5f152c56ba1561a9ffd2f0e1ff22b68253d9ad203d91a3a53540191c